Implementación de un sistema de información basado en Scrum con PHP y MySQL para la gestión eclesiástica en la iglesia evangélica Renuevo año 2023
Date
2024Author(s)
Ortiz Abanto, Luis Moisés
Vásquez Saavedra, Kevin Niler
Metadata
Show full item recordAbstract
En la presente investigación, se desarrolló la implementación de un sistema
de información basado en Scrum con PHP y MySQL para la gestión
eclesiástica en la Iglesia Evangélica Renuevo. el cual consiste en proponer
mejoras en la gestión administrativa, utilizando los sistemas de información como
aliados para una toma de decisiones más informada. Para el desarrollo del
sistema web, se recopiló la información necesaria del proceso actual.
Posteriormente, se identificaron procesos ambiguos y se realizaron mejoras en el
proceso actual. Esto resultó en un mapeo de una gestión más eficiente para la
iglesia. Para recopilar información, se llevaron a cabo entrevistas con el pastor
encargado de la gestión administrativa y se aplicaron encuestas a los miembros
líderes. Con los requerimientos recopilados, se procedió a construir el Product
Backlog y se dio inicio a su desarrollo. El marco de trabajo empleado para el
desarrollo del sistema fue Scrum, dividiéndolo en tres Sprints. El lenguaje de
programación utilizado fue PHP y MySQL. Para la implementación del entorno
del proyecto, se utilizó GitHub, con cinco ramas distintas, cada una con un
propósito específico. Luego de las pruebas e implementación del sistema de
información, se implantó el sistema. Para el dominio y configuración de DNS, se
utilizaron los servicios de Cloudflare. El despliegue se llevó a cabo en el sitio web
CPanel y WHM como hosting. Se realizaron las pruebas correspondientes para
contrastar el correcto funcionamiento del sistema de información y se verificó
que el sistema funcionó correctamente para todos los involucrados en el proceso
de gestión administrativa en la iglesia. In the present research, the implementation of an information system based on
Scrum with PHP and MySQL for ecclesiastical management in the Evangelical
Church Renuevo was developed. This system aims to propose improvements in
administrative management, using information systems as allies for more informed
decision-making. For the development of the web system, necessary information
from the current process was collected. Subsequently, ambiguous processes were
identified, and improvements were made to the current process. This resulted in a
more efficient management structure for the church. To collect information,
interviews were conducted with the pastor in charge of administrative
management, and surveys were administered to the leading members. With the
gathered requirements, the Product Backlog was constructed, and its development
began. The framework employed for system development was Scrum, divided into
three sprints. The programming language used was PHP and MySQL. For project
environment implementation, GitHub was used, with five different branches, each
serving a specific purpose. After testing and implementing the information system,
it was deployed. Cloudflare services were utilized for domain and DNS
configuration. Deployment occurred on the CPanel and WHM website hosting
platform. Relevant tests were conducted to verify the proper functioning of the
information system. It was confirmed that the system operated correctly for all
those involved in the administrative management process within the church